Abstract

LSU 03 Aircraft was used for LSU MISI with capability cruise up to 340 km. LSU 03 has an operation for marine safety from illegal fishing. To support the monitoring mission of illegal fishing with operation range up to 250 km or 3 hours flight, several required system are needed such as autopilot system, datalink, propulsion, and payload. All of system then analysed by an ELA (Electrical Load Assessment) of the aircraft system to know the necessary power required to conduct the initial mission of the aircraft. ELA analysis is done by calculating the power requirement from each component specification and function test of the component for validation of calculation result. From the results of the study, the amount of power consumption is 35% from the spec calculation, which is 32.43 Wh which can be accommodated by a battery system up to 4.2 hours. Whereas for ignition or aircraft engines whose source of battery uses LIPO 2S 7.4 Vdc batteries can accommodate the ignition energy requirements for more than 11 hours.
